EXAMINATIONS AND PROMOTIONS

  1. There will be four round of weekly tests and four terminal examinations in one academic year. The maximum marks for each weekly test will be 20 and the term exam will be of 100 marks.
  2. The promotion of the students will be granted if he/she brings 45% marks in each subject. will be added at the final promotion of the student.
  3. Any students who fails in more than two subjects cannot be promoted.
  4. If the student remains absent for any exam, test will be given zero and no re-exam will be taken under any consideration.
  5. Final exam is compulsory to attend.
  6. A pupil who fails a second time in the same standard may be asked to leave the school.
  7. Promotion refused, will not be reconsidered under any circumstances.
  8. A pupil who takes or gives dishonest help at an examination will be given zero in the subject and he/she will be debarred from the rest of the examination.
  9. Report card should be collected on the report card distribution day otherwise the student are not allowed to enter the class from the next day until they take their report card.

EARLY GOING

Early going of pupils will be allowed only in unavoidable circumstances. The parent/guardian should get permission from the Principal for the early going of his/her child. Any verbal or written request from persons other than parents/guardians, will not be entertained. Moreover, written requests from parents/guardians sent through messengers will not be considered.

ATTENDANCE

A student must have put in a minimum of 85% of attendance for promotion to the higher class. Shortage of 15% can be condoned by the Principal on medical grounds. Shortage beyond this limit will not be condoned.

LEAVE OF ABSENCE

Any absence must be explained in the form of a leave note on the page provided for this purpose in the Diary and it must be signed by the parent and should be countersigned by the Principal. Pupils who absent themselves from the school without permission for more than 15 consecutive working days will be removed from the school.
